Court freezes Oyo Govt’s bank accounts over N3.5 billion debt

An FCT High Court sitting in Abuja has issued a garnishee order for the freezing of 10 commercial bank accounts operated by the Oyo State Government over N3.5 billion debt.

The order, issued by Justice Anitte Ebong, was initiated by former council chiefs in Oyo State who were sacked by Governor Seyi Makinde.

The former council of chiefs then got a N4.9 billion judgement against the governor and other officials and agencies of the state.

The garnishee proceeding is intended by the ex-council chiefs, led by Bashorun Majeed Ajuwon, to recover the balance of N3.5 billion which is outstanding from the actual judgement sum, from which Makinde paid only N1.5bn in 2022.

The banks in which the Oyo State Government’s accounts are blocked are Zenith Bank, United Bank of Africa (UBA), Wema Bank, First Bank of Nigeria, Ecobank, Guaranty Trust Bank, Access Bank, Polaris Bank, Jaiz Bank and Union Bank.

Justice Ebong ordered the banks to file affidavits and attend the court on the next adjourned date to show cause why the garnishee orders nisi hereby granted should not be made absolute.

The judge awarded N300,000.00 as a cost against the judgement debtors and ordered that a copy of the order be served on Makinde and others and adjourned till January 5 next year for hearing.
